Output 21c2bb66e812270c75a4d4884cbf2e4984673eebf617841c1803abcc3b0e0c2c:0

value
108626
script pubkey
OP_0 OP_PUSHBYTES_20 44f28c5afe6630bc629c01c216e6352474654be5
address
bc1qgnegckh7vcctcc5uq8ppde34y36x2jl9k7ypxy
transaction
21c2bb66e812270c75a4d4884cbf2e4984673eebf617841c1803abcc3b0e0c2c
confirmations
363517
spent
true